Griffin Boss

Stock Analyst at B. Riley Securities

(1.00)
# 3,909
Out of 5,117 analysts
2
Total ratings
50%
Success rate
-4.46%
Average return
Main Sectors:

Stocks Rated by Griffin Boss

American Public Education
Nov 11, 2025
Maintains: Buy
Price Target: $37$40
Current: $38.09
Upside: +5.01%
Phoenix Education Partners
Nov 4, 2025
Initiates: Buy
Price Target: $60
Current: $32.46
Upside: +84.84%